What is a Gearbox?
A gearbox, also known as a transmission, is a system of gears that adjusts the engine's power and directs it to the wheels in varying amounts, depending on the required speed and load conditions. The gearbox achieves this by shifting between different gear ratios, which allows the engine to operate within an efficient range of power.
There are two main types of gearboxes used in Land Rover vehicles:
- Manual Gearbox: In a manual transmission, the driver is responsible for manually shifting gears using a clutch pedal and gear lever. This provides greater control over the vehicle’s performance, especially in off-road conditions.
- Automatic Gearbox: In an automatic transmission, the gearbox shifts gears automatically without the need for the driver to intervene. This makes driving easier and more comfortable, particularly in urban or highway conditions.

Why is the Land Rover Gearbox Important?
The Land Rover Gearbox is responsible for ensuring the vehicle performs optimally, whether you’re driving through rough terrain or on the road. Here's why it's so essential:
- Power Distribution: The gearbox ensures that the engine’s power is effectively transmitted to the wheels. It adjusts the power output to match the driving conditions, whether you’re cruising on a highway or navigating challenging off-road environments.
- Smooth Driving Experience: A properly functioning gearbox ensures smooth and consistent driving by shifting gears at the right time. Whether you’re accelerating, decelerating, or climbing steep inclines, the gearbox ensures that the power is delivered smoothly for a comfortable driving experience.
- Fuel Efficiency: The gearbox plays a role in optimizing fuel efficiency by controlling engine speeds and reducing unnecessary fuel consumption. By shifting gears at the optimal times, it helps the vehicle run efficiently and conserve fuel.
- Off-Road Capability: In Land Rover vehicles, the gearbox is integral to off-road performance. Many models are equipped with low-range gearboxes to provide extra torque when navigating challenging terrain. This allows the vehicle to crawl over obstacles with ease and provide better control.
- Safety and Performance: The gearbox also ensures that the vehicle performs safely in a variety of driving conditions. For instance, when driving up or down steep hills, the gearbox helps maintain control and prevent the vehicle from stalling or rolling.
Common Issues with Land Rover Gearboxes
Over time, gearboxes can experience wear and tear, and certain issues may arise. Common problems with Land Rover Gearboxes include:
- Slipping Gears: If the gearbox slips out of gear or has difficulty staying in gear, it may indicate worn-out gears, low fluid levels, or other internal issues that need to be addressed.
- Grinding or Unusual Noises: If you hear grinding, whining, or clunking noises while shifting, this could be a sign of worn bearings, damaged gears, or low transmission fluid levels.
- Delayed or Rough Shifting: If the vehicle hesitates before shifting gears or the gear changes feel jerky or rough, it may indicate a problem with the gearbox’s fluid or internal components.
- Fluid Leaks: Transmission fluid leaks can cause a significant drop in the fluid levels, which can damage the gearbox over time. If you notice red or brown fluid under the vehicle, it may be time to check the gearbox.
- Warning Lights: The appearance of a transmission-related warning light on the dashboard may indicate a problem with the gearbox. This could be due to low fluid, overheating, or internal damage to the transmission system.
- Loss of Power or Acceleration: If the vehicle struggles to accelerate or feels like it’s losing power, it may indicate a problem with the gearbox or its associated components.
